XL 2021 Calcul des âges

DomL

XLDnaute Occasionnel
Supporter XLD
Bonjour le Forum



Non spécialiste d'Excel et de Forum

J'avais interrogé Excel Downloads, pour un calcul : connaitre, l'âge d'une personne, en fonction de sa date de naissance


Le Forum, m'avait proposé 2 formules intéressantes, qui m'avait apporté LES SOLUTIONS :

=SI(A2="";"";DATEDIF(A2;AUJOURDHUI();"Y")) : nombre d'année de la personne, à ''AUJOURDHUI''


=SI(A2="";"";(AUJOURDHUI()-A2)/365) : nombre d'année de la personne, dans l'année en cours (après son anniversaire)




A l'usage, j'ai repéré un BUG : tous les calculs fonctionnent, sauf ...

... pour les mois de : septembre, octobre, novembre et décembre, quelle que soit l'année, le calcul bug !!!
J'ai souligné en orange quelques lignes, dans le tableau joint




Est-ce que, l'un d'entre vous, avec un regard sur le tableau : comprendrait le problème ? SVP



Comme toujours, d'avance merci

DL
 

Pièces jointes

  • + 50 ans.xlsx
    237 KB · Affichages: 11

Modeste geedee

XLDnaute Barbatruc
Bonjour à tous,
Code:
=((AUJOURDHUI()-A2)+1)/365,25
Code:
=NB.JOURS.OUVRES.INTL(A2;AUJOURDHUI();"0000000")/365,25
JHA
Bonsour®
😎
[Mode la mouche du coche]
!!! dérive sur 400 ans...(selon le calendrier grégorien)
pour plus précision il convient d'ajouter une correction
365,2425 au lieu de 365,25
seuls les années séculaires multiples de 400 sont bissextiles
(1900, 2100,2200,2300 ne le sont pas)
[/Mode mouche du coche]
😌 wait & see
 

Discussions similaires

Statistiques des forums

Discussions
315 096
Messages
2 116 184
Membres
112 678
dernier inscrit
arno12345678